March 19, 2010

Alıntı (canalpay):

>

Normalde kaynak kodu açık değil mi ?

Evet, açık kodlu. Benim ortamımda derleme uyarıları olmuştu; onları da söylemiştim. Daha çok o tür hatalar kalmasın diye asıl sürümden bir kaç gün önce bir de ben bakmış olacağım.

Alıntı:

>

Bu arada şunuda unutmamak lazım. İnsan doğduktan 2 yıl sonra anca bir iki sözcük söyleyebiliyor. 4-5 yılda az çok sözcük söyleyebiliyor.

Dört yaş civarında kelime sayısında müthiş bir patlama yaşanıyor.

Alıntı:

>

İnsanlar beynini %5 ile %10 arasında kullanabiliyormuş

Evet çok söyleniyor ama hiçbir dayanağı yok. :/

Alıntı:

>

Bazı kesimler beynimizi büyük oranda kullanırsak istediğimiz cismi hareket ettirebileceğimizi

Aslında çok kolay: Eğer beynin belirli bir noktasındaki elektronları aynı yöne çevirebilirsek beynimizi mıknatıs haline getirebiliriz ve manyetik olan cisimleri yürütebiliriz. :-p

Alıntı:

>

başkaların içinden geçenleri algılayabilceğimizi söylüyor

O da çok kolay: Eğer beynin yukarıda sözü geçen noktasını radyo alıcısı gibi kullanmayı öğrenirsek bu da olabilir. :-p

Ali

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]

March 19, 2010

Alıntı (canalpay):

>

c++ dosyalarını nasıl D'ye dönüştüreceğiz. Dahan C için bile yapamadık :-)
Yoksa biz mi ona benzer kodlar yazacağız ?

Evet, D için baştan yazılması gerekiyor.

İşin güzel tarafı, Castor çok küçük bir kütüphane. Zaten 'logic paradigm' çok az sayıda temel üzerine kurulu.

Ali

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]

March 20, 2010

Bencede çok güzel.

Tabiki bazı sorularım olacak. :-)

Hangi dilin editörü olacak ? (Sanırım pythonun :-) )

Kaynak kodlarını açacak mısınız ?
Bunu sormamın nedeni gtkD ile nasıl şeyler yaparı(z)(m) öğrenebilmek için.

Birde editör hakkında merak ettiğim şey yeni dil desteği olacak mı ? Olacaksa nasıl olacak ? Emacs gibi dosyayı biz hazırlayabilcek miyiz ?

Alıntı:

>

yalniz uzun sure python ile calisinca, D gibi derlenen bir dili kullanmak cidden cok zor geliyor insana.

Banada zor gelmişti.

Ben hiç derlenen bir dil kullanmadığım için çok zor geliyordu.
Ama size derlemesi zor gelyorsa 'rdmd' ile yorumlanabilen bir dil gibi çalıştırabilirsiniz.

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]

March 20, 2010

ustadlar yapmayin daha hicbir sey yok :) dikey scrollar bile cikmiyor. :P

File Browser'a yapilacaklar:

  1. bir elemana tiklandiginda, o eleman klasorse icerigini gosterecek, dosyaysa dosyayi acacak.
  2. geri, ust klasor ve yenile dugmeleri konulacak.

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]

March 20, 2010

hocam kusura bakma, ilk mesaji biraz hizli yazdim evden cikmak uzereydim, o yuzden sana cevap veremedim.

Alıntı (canalpay):

>

Hangi dilin editörü olacak ? (Sanırım pythonun :-) )

herhangi bir dilin editoru olmayacak cunku diller icin zibilyon tane editor var, yet another programming editor yapmaya gerek yok. o yuzden benim hedef kitlem web framework kullananlar. mesela ruby on rails, django, turbogears, web2py, cakephp, codeigniter gibi. tabii bu frameworkleri desteklerken dilleri de desteklemek gerekiyor.

Alıntı:

>

Kaynak kodlarını açacak mısınız ?

ben acik kaynakciyim o yuzden kaynak kodlari tabii ki acacagim. ancak yazilim muhtemelen "free as in freedom" seklinde olacak, "free beer" seklinde olmaz diye dusunuyorum fakat daha kararimi vermis degilim.

Alıntı:

>

Bunu sormamın nedeni gtkD ile nasıl şeyler yaparı(z)(m) öğrenebilmek için.

madem ali ustad d dersleri yaziyor, ben de vaktim oldukca gtkD dersleri yazarim, bu sekilde bizim de bir katkimiz olmus olur. editor acik kaynak olacak ama uc gun bes gun icerisinde cikmayacak, sonuc itibariyle buyuk bir proje dusunuyorum, bitmesi bir yil dahi surebilir. :)

Alıntı:

>

Birde editör hakkında merak ettiğim şey yeni dil desteği olacak mı ? Olacaksa nasıl olacak ? Emacs gibi dosyayı biz hazırlayabilcek miyiz ?

aslinda ben boyle bir sey dusunmemistim ama olabilir. emacs nasil yapiyor bir fikrim yok acikcasi fakat sonuc itibariyle bir seyler dusunulebilir. kullanici icin yapmasi ne kadar kolay olur onun icin de bir fikrim yok suan. :)

Alıntı:

>

Banada zor gelmişti.

Ben hiç derlenen bir dil kullanmadığım için çok zor geliyordu.
Ama size derlemesi zor gelyorsa 'rdmd' ile yorumlanabilen bir dil gibi çalıştırabilirsiniz.

rdmd super aletmis, tesekkurler. :) derlenen dillerde debugging anlik olarak yapilamadigi icin problemli oluyor kanimca. mesela python'daki dir() ve ruby'deki inspect() metodlari benim isimi hem daha kolay hem daha hizli yapmami sagliyor. veya siniflara disaridan attribute atayabilmek buyuk fayda sagliyor.

bu arada File Browser'a scrollbar ekledim. :) http://omploader.org/vM3c1ZQ/out-7.ogv

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]

March 19, 2010

Konunun ilk mesajı Mengü'den:

Alıntı (Mengu:1269053463):

>

evet, sizler icin kucuk bir editor yaziyorum gtkD ile :) yalniz ancak file browser kismini halledebildim. :)

ufak video: http://omploader.org/vM3Z6cw/out-6.ogv :)

yalniz uzun sure python ile calisinca, D gibi derlenen bir dili kullanmak cidden cok zor geliyor insana.

Bu haliyle çok güzel. :)

Ali

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]

March 20, 2010

Alıntı:

>

herhangi bir dilin editoru olmayacak cunku diller icin zibilyon tane editor var, yet another programming editor yapmaya gerek yok. o yuzden benim hedef kitlem web framework kullananlar. mesela ruby on rails, django, turbogears, web2py, cakephp, codeigniter gibi. tabii bu frameworkleri desteklerken dilleri de desteklemek gerekiyor.

Zaten sizin frameworklari çok sevdiğinizi biliyorum. Siteniz sırf framework ile ilgili :-) Bir ara siz D için framework olmaz demiştiniz ama neden dediğinizi öğrenebilir miyim ? Sonuçta benim bildiğim frameworkler asıl C D ve Python gibi diller için işe yarıyor. Php'yi bir çok kişi zaten C'nin frameworku olarak adlandırıyor.
Ayrıca Benim bildiğim kadarı ile aslında Python'da frameworkler olmasa web için D'den daha yatkın değil diye biliyorum. Ama bu konuda bilgim çok az.

Alıntı:

>

madem ali ustad d dersleri yaziyor, ben de vaktim oldukca gtkD dersleri yazarim, bu sekilde bizim de bir katkimiz olmus olur. editor acik kaynak olacak ama uc gun bes gun icerisinde cikmayacak, sonuc itibariyle buyuk bir proje dusunuyorum, bitmesi bir yil dahi surebilir.

gtkD derslerinizi heyecanla bekliyorum. ddili.org/wiki de derslerinizi oluşturabilirsiniz.(Ya da kendi sitenizde.)
Ama lütfen oluşturun. Ben şimdi baktım ve tüm gtkler çok farklı gibi geldi bana. Bu yüzden anlamıyorum.

Alıntı:

>

aslinda ben boyle bir sey dusunmemistim ama olabilir. emacs nasil yapiyor bir fikrim yok acikcasi fakat sonuc itibariyle bir seyler dusunulebilir. kullanici icin yapmasi ne kadar kolay olur onun icin de bir fikrim yok suan.

En azından şöyle bir şey olabilir diye düşünüyorum:

renklendirme için anahtar sözcükler yanlarına renk kodları konur. sizin editörünüz o renk koduna göre renklendirir.

Alıntı:

>

bu arada File Browser'a scrollbar ekledim. http://omploader.org/vM3c1ZQ/out-7.ogv

Çok hoş olmuş.

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]

March 20, 2010

Alıntı (canalpay):

>

Zaten sizin frameworklari çok sevdiğinizi biliyorum. Siteniz sırf framework ile ilgili :-) Bir ara siz D için framework olmaz demiştiniz ama neden dediğinizi öğrenebilir miyim ? Sonuçta benim bildiğim frameworkler asıl C D ve Python gibi diller için işe yarıyor. Php'yi bir çok kişi zaten C'nin frameworku olarak adlandırıyor.
Ayrıca Benim bildiğim kadarı ile aslında Python'da frameworkler olmasa web için D'den daha yatkın değil diye biliyorum. Ama bu konuda bilgim çok az.

uzun suredir web gelistirmeyle ugrasiyorum, o yuzden az cok bazi konularda fikirlerim oturmus durumda. D framework yazilacak dil degil, D ile web sunucusu yazarsiniz veya D ile bir web programlama dili yazarsiniz. framework dedigimiz sey, bir dile ait en cok kullanilan kutuphanelerin bir araya getirilmesi ve kullanilmasidir bu kadar. ek olarak, php'ye framework diyeni dovuyorlar. :)

Alıntı:

>

gtkD derslerinizi heyecanla bekliyorum. ddili.org/wiki de derslerinizi oluşturabilirsiniz.(Ya da kendi sitenizde.)
Ama lütfen oluşturun. Ben şimdi baktım ve tüm gtkler çok farklı gibi geldi bana. Bu yüzden anlamıyorum.

en kisa surede baslayacagim. oncelikle ali ustadla gorusmem gerek ki standartlarini bileyim, ona gore yazayim.

Alıntı:

>

En azından şöyle bir şey olabilir diye düşünüyorum:

renklendirme için anahtar sözcükler yanlarına renk kodları konur. sizin editörünüz o renk koduna göre renklendirir.

o anahtar kelimelerin regex ile yazilmasi gerekir ki tam eslesme olsun ve dogru renklendirme yapilabilsin.

Alıntı:

>

Çok hoş olmuş.

tesekkur ediyorum. :)

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]

March 20, 2010

Alıntı (Mengu):

>

en kisa surede baslayacagim. oncelikle ali ustadla gorusmem gerek ki standartlarini bileyim, ona gore yazayim.

Yazım kurallarına uygunluk dışında bir standart yok. :)

Derslerin nerede olacakları tamamen sana kalır. Eğer ddili.org'da bulunmasını istersen, yeri şurası olur:

http://ddili.org/ders/index.html

Ama kendi sitende durması daha doğal gelirse, biz o sayfadan seninkine bağlantı koyarız.

Alıntı:

>

o anahtar kelimelerin regex ile yazilmasi gerekir ki tam eslesme olsun ve dogru renklendirme yapilabilsin.

PHP için bu sitedeki kodları da renklendiren GeSHi var:

http://qbnz.com/highlighter/

Belki ondan yararlanılabilir veya fikirler edinilebilir.

Ali

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]

March 21, 2010

Alıntı (acehreli):

>

Yazım kurallarına uygunluk dışında bir standart yok. :)

Derslerin nerede olacakları tamamen sana kalır. Eğer ddili.org'da bulunmasını istersen, yeri şurası olur:

http://ddili.org/ders/index.html

Ama kendi sitende durması daha doğal gelirse, biz o sayfadan seninkine bağlantı koyarız.

D'nin Turkce yeri burasi, o yuzden derslerin burada olmasinda hicbir problem yok benim icin ustad.

Alıntı:

>

PHP için bu sitedeki kodları da renklendiren GeSHi var:

http://qbnz.com/highlighter/

Belki ondan yararlanılabilir veya fikirler edinilebilir.

Ali

geshi'den ve pygments'ten faydalanacagim zaten, yoksa mumkun degil ben o ifadeleri yazamam. :D

--
[ Bu gönderi, http://ddili.org/forum'dan dönüştürülmüştür. ]